We are seeking highly motivated professionals to join our established PSDP team - based in Dublin. Hybrid working is supported, once suitably located to facilitate monthly site visits required across a wide range of live projects. You'll work independently while reporting to the PSDP Associate Director and following robust QA procedures.
Key Responsibilities- Lead the role of Project Supervisor Design Process (PSDP) on multiple projects.
- Advise clients and design teams on SHWW (Construction) Regulations.
- Identify and mitigate design related hazards.
- Prepare hazard identification registers and Preliminary Safety & Health Plans.
- Coordinate with PSCS, contractors, and temporary works designers.
- Attend site meetings and ensure compliance with safety legislation.
- Compile and issue Safety Files upon project completion.
- Contribute to continuous improvement of internal PSDP procedures.
- Minimum 3 years' experience in construction, engineering, or architectural roles.
- Proven experience in a PSDP, PSCS, or similar H&S advisory role.
- Strong understanding of architectural drawings and construction site operations.
- Excellent communication, reporting, and IT skills (MS Word & Excel).
- Ability to manage multiple projects and work independently.
- Full clean driving licence and access to own vehicle.
- 3rd Level Diploma or Certificate in Safety, Health & Welfare (e.g., HDip SHWW, CSHWW).
- Chartered or working towards chartership with IOSH, RIAI, or IEI.
- Construction related qualifications also considered.
- Design related qualifications also considered once SHWW has been achieved.
